7" LED or H4 headlamp conversion for 1/4 the price of Retrobrights!
Get them while you can...won't take long for Toyota to discover the secret is out.
Toyota part number 81110-60P70
This should work in any car with 7" round sealed beam 12v lamps. I've heard they will work on motorcycles also but may require modification to mount--not confirmed.
To my knowledge and that of the internet wizards who found this hack, there are no kits for square or quad lamp setups, sorry.

You mentioned water/moisture could get in, from which area would the moisture/water get in from ? From the rear black rubber grommet or the front glass area ?
The rubber 'condom' is designed to seal tightly around the H4 bulb. It can't do that with the LED. There is no rubber o-ring on H4 bulb style attachments like there is on 'modern' headlamps, so I suspect moisture could possibly wick in. But I may be worried about nothing.

I have a 2011 865 (fake carbs, 17" wheels) and I am pretty happy about it (I have six other bikes in the garage...) I agree with most of the comments here. I find the saddle ridiculously hard, it's clearly designed for the looks only. I did not feel like spending several hundreds euros, I solved the issue with a an inflatable pillow from SW Tec, it works pretty well, and raised the seat level (I am 6'). Suspensions too were ridiculously stiff, making for a horrible handling. I put YSS rear shocks on, and progressive springs in front (15W oil) Incidentally my 1985 Moto Guzzi came with progressive springs from the factory.... The rear view in mirrors is OK to me. I miss an RPM meter, but I a trying to get used to this lack. Brakes are OK, one should not be fooled by the "lack" of the second front disk. I too installed a central stand (costly item). The 17" wheels makes cornering unnaturally swift, I am used to heavier and longer bikes with 18 and 19" from wheels, so I need to calibrate myself every time I take this. I installed an original rear rack, with a top case, that I find useful due to the lack of storage mentioned here
